Mccurry Park South Local Area Guide
McCurry Park South in Fayetteville, Georgia, serves as a central hub for local sports and recreation, particularly for youth baseball and softball. This guide is designed for players, coaches, families, and team coordinators looking to navigate the park and its surrounding amenities. You'll find practical information on arrival, amenities within the park, nearby dining options, and local tips to ensure a smooth and enjoyable experience for your team and family.
Area contextNeighborhood Overview – McCurry Park South (Fayetteville, GA)
McCurry Park South is situated in Fayetteville, a growing suburban city south of Atlanta. The park is easily accessible from Georgia State Route 85 (Fayetteville Road) and has direct access via McDonough Road. For travelers coming from the north or south on I-85, the park is a straightforward drive off the highway. The nearest major airport is Hartsfield-Jackson Atlanta International Airport (ATL), located approximately 20-25 miles northwest of Fayetteville. Driving times to the park can vary significantly based on Atlanta traffic, especially during peak commute hours. While there is no direct public transit to McCurry Park South, rideshare services can be utilized, though they are less common for game day transport to this specific location. Smart arrival tactics involve planning your journey to account for potential congestion on local roads, particularly on weekend mornings when tournaments are in full swing. Arriving at least 30-45 minutes before scheduled game times is advisable to secure parking and navigate to your designated field without rushing.

Weather & Seasons at McCurry Park South
- Winter: Winter in Fayetteville brings cool to cold temperatures, with averages ranging from the high 30s to the low 50s Fahrenheit. Visitors should pack warm layers, including jackets, sweaters, and long pants. Early morning games might require hats and gloves, while afternoons can be comfortable with lighter outerwear. The grounds are generally accessible, though occasional frost or light rain can make fields damp.
- Spring & early summer: Spring and early summer offer mild to warm weather, perfect for sports. Temperatures typically range from the 60s to the 80s Fahrenheit. Light jackets or long-sleeve shirts are useful for cooler mornings and evenings. Sunscreen and hats become essential as the season progresses into early summer, anticipating warmer days ahead. This period generally sees good field conditions.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er brings significant heat and humidity, with daytime temperatures often soaring into the 90s Fahrenheit and feeling hotter due to humidity. Light, breathable clothing is a must, along with constant hydration. Sunscreen, hats, and seeking shade between games are critical. Be prepared for possible afternoon thunderstorms, which can cause delays but typically pass quickly.
- Fall season: Fall offers a welcome reprieve from summer heat, with crisp air and comfortable temperatures typically in the 50s to 70s Fahrenheit. It's an ideal time for outdoor events. Layers are recommended, as mornings can be cool and afternoons pleasant. The park's natural beauty is enhanced by changing foliage, making it a scenic time for competition.
- Rain & snow: Rain is common throughout the year, especially in spring and summer, often appearing as scattered showers or thunderstorms that can cause temporary delays. Snow is infrequent but can occur in winter, usually as light dustings that melt quickly. Heavy precipitation can lead to field closures for safety and preservation. Always check park status updates during inclement weather.
